Claims Verification and Red Flags ⚠️ Red Flags Detected Multiple red flags indicate potential phishing activity. The site claims to be a financial service provider but lacks essential verification. Phishing Indicator: The site requests sensitive information (phone number and password) without clear service offerings. Domain Age: The domain is only 64 days old, raising concerns about its legitimacy. SPF and DMARC Records: The absence of SPF and DMARC records indicates a lack of email security measures. SSL Certificate: While the site has an SSL certificate, it is a Domain Validated (DV) certificate, which does not guarantee legitimacy. Content Quality: The site has minimal content, primarily focused on login, which is typical of phishing sites. ⚠️ Caution Points Users should verify the legitimacy of any financial service before providing personal information. Be cautious of sites that require login information without clear service descriptions. Check for regulatory licenses independently, as claims may be misleading. Security Note: The site uses a DV SSL certificate, which does not guarantee the identity of the owner.
